Brazilian Picanha Steak with Chimichurri and Roasted Vegetables
Prep 20 min · Cook 30 min · Serves 3 · medium

Tender Brazilian-style grilled picanha steak served with a vibrant chimichurri sauce and a medley of roasted vegetables for a flavorful and nutritious dinner.
Ingredients
- 1.5 lbs picanha steak
- 1 cup parsley, chopped
- 2 tbsp oregano, chopped
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 3 tbsp red wine vinegar
- 1/4 cup olive oil
- 1 red bell pepper
- 2 zucchini
- 1 red onion
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
Instructions
- 1
Preheat oven to 400°F. Cut the bell pepper, zucchini, and red onion into 1-inch pieces. Toss the vegetables with 2 tbsp olive oil, salt, and pepper. Spread on a baking sheet and roast for 20-25 minutes, stirring halfway, until tender and lightly charred.
- 2
In a small bowl, combine the chopped parsley, oregano, minced garlic, red wine vinegar, and 1/4 cup olive oil. Stir to make the chimichurri sauce.
